Laptops almost certain!

Desktops, especially as cheap as Dell is... NO NO NO!
It needs the auto or manual transformer switch.. similar to other manufacturer's though many have discontinued on their cheap line.
In my opinion.. everything from Dell is a cheap line, aka disposable... but call them and ask.
Monitor.. I'm not even sure its possible, at least a CRT.. possible on an LCD.

I work for a computer reseller.... dump the desktop since the transformer et al, is a pain. As others have posted the laptop should just be a plug conversion. They've gotten cheap enough either buy another laptop or live with that...
